A copper bar of resistance 40 µΩ rests on two parallel rails 20 cm apart. When a voltage of 1.6 mV is applied between the rails, the dynamometer holding the bar reads 4 N. What is the flux density normal to the plane of the rails?
Parametric exercise: the values change with every draw; these are one example.
I = U / R = 1.6·10⁻³ / (40·10⁻⁶) = 40 A; B = F / (I · l) = 4 / (40 × 20·10⁻²) = 0.5 T.
